7 Replies Latest reply: May 21, 2014 3:11 PM by JeffJon RSS

    FDM EE call ODI Agent with wrong URL

    James.zhang

      I cannot execute import step at FDM EE, there is error says "ODIAgent may not be running".

       

      So I checked at log file and find something at ErpIntegrator0.log.

       

      There is such error message.

       

      [2014-05-11T23:21:58.055+08:00] [EPMServer0] [ERROR] [EPMERPI-101501] [oracle.apps.erpi.model] [tid: 28] [userId: <anonymous>] [ecid: 00iLvUeUTjeFw0zxBJ0DJz18Vei3jnmzu00032K00004y,0:1:1] [APP: AIF#11.1.2.0] [URI: /workspace/logon] [SRC_CLASS: com.hyperion.aif.util.RuleServiceExecutor] [SRC_METHOD: executeDataRule] An Error occurred while invoking ODI process.[[

      oracle.odi.runtime.agent.invocation.InvocationException: ODI-1424: Agent host or port cannot be reached using http://192.168.8.30:9000/oraclediagent.

        at oracle.odi.runtime.agent.invocation.RemoteRuntimeAgentInvoker.reThrowAgentErrorAsInvocation(RemoteRuntimeAgentInvoker.java:1301)

        at oracle.odi.runtime.agent.invocation.RemoteRuntimeAgentInvoker.invoke(RemoteRuntimeAgentInvoker.java:277)

        at oracle.odi.runtime.agent.invocation.RemoteRuntimeAgentInvoker.invokeStartScenario(RemoteRuntimeAgentInvoker.java:598)

        at oracle.odi.runtime.agent.invocation.RemoteRuntimeAgentInvoker.invokeStartScenario(RemoteRuntimeAgentInvoker.java:559)

        at com.hyperion.aif.gl.common.util.model.applicationModule.GLIntegrationBaseAMImpl.invoke_odi_process(GLIntegrationBaseAMImpl.java:606)

        at com.hyperion.aif.util.RuleServiceExecutor.executeDataRule(RuleServiceExecutor.java:299)

        at com.hyperion.aif.gl.common.data.model.applicationModule.DataRuleAMImpl.executeRule(DataRuleAMImpl.java:1261)

        at com.hyperion.aif.workbench.model.applicationModule.WorkBenchAMImpl.execDataRule(WorkBenchAMImpl.java:1495)

        at com.hyperion.aif.workbench.model.applicationModule.WorkBenchAMImpl.executeImport(WorkBenchAMImpl.java:1334)

        at com.hyperion.aif.workbench.userinterface.backing.WorkBenchBacking.executeRule(WorkBenchBacking.java:183)

        at com.hyperion.aif.workbench.userinterface.backing.WorkBenchBacking.exeWindowListener(WorkBenchBacking.java:669)

        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)

        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)

        at java.lang.reflect.Method.invoke(Method.java:597)

       

      ...

       

      I can see http://192.168.8.30:9000/oraclediagent is incorrect. Because current server's IP is 192.168.8.22.

       

      However, I do not know this incorrect IP is configured at which part of FDM EE. How can I change it to make it correct?

       

      Thanks.

       

      James Zhang